The Esmeralda takes its name from the emerald colour of the Mediterranean sea and is produced with Moscatel of Alexandria (85%) and Gewurztraminer (15%). It exhibits floral aromas with hints of passion fruit and banana.

Intense. It is characterized by terpenic notes (rose and lavender), floral (jasmine) and touches of citrus fruit (orange). The palate is fine and elegant. Terpenic notes reappear. The finish is very long.
